Ephesus Kinns and Holt 2023 Period III, AR XV, Silver, struck at Ephesus, 320–281 BC. Obverse: bee abeille. Reverse: forepart of stag running, head turned and palm tree. Weight about 5.2 g, diameter 19.0 mm.
